Roses

i have a 4ft high fence. Is this too low to plant a Gertrude Jekyll climber and if so will it flower at ground level?

Posts

  • NollieNollie Posts: 7,529
    I have a two-year old in a pot, the canes are fairly upright and very thorny, with care I think you could gently persuade it along wires fixed to your fence. I think you could manage to contain the height that way and you will get more blooms lower down, too.

    Maybe others have more direct experience of doing this...?
